  2. Minor front end collisions can cost big bucks on BMW 5 and 6 Series AUTOMOTIVE NEWS[/url] Posted Date: 10/27/05 Note to owners of BMW 5- and 6 Series cars: Drive with care. Even slight damage to the front of the car can be expensive. In some cases, insurers are declaring a lightly wrecked car a total loss. Why? Because the front end of the car -- built with high-tech aluminum, rivets and glue -- can be hard to repair, according to the Los Angeles Times. The front-end structure, which includes an aluminum firewall and body rails, weighs only 100 pounds. The minimal weight helps BMW achieve an ideal 50/50 fore-aft weight balance for better road handling. Because tolerances are so tight, if the front structure is bent by more than 1 millimeter in a crash, it must be replaced, not bent back to place, BMW says. The automaker recommends that repairmen be specially trained and use only BMW-certified tools and supplies, such as rivets. Experts say it can cost an independent repair shop as much as $100,000 for the training and special tools
